George Condo

George Condo is an American painter known for his distinctive blend of traditional European painting techniques with contemporary figuration. Born in Concord, New Hampshire in 1957, he studied art history and music theory at the University of Massachusetts before moving to New York in the early 1980s. Condo rose to prominence with his “Artificial Realism,” a style that merges classical forms with distorted, cartoon-like characters. His work references artists from Velázquez to Picasso while injecting a dark, surreal humour. Condo has remained a major influence in contemporary art, bridging old master painting with modern psychological intensity.
